The parameters passed to allow_link and drop_link functions are never NULL. That means the result of container_of() on those parameters is also never NULL, even though the reference into the structure points to the first element of the structure. Remove the unnecessary NULL checks. This change was made automatically with the following Coccinelle script. A now obsolete 'out:' label was removed manually. @@ type t; identifier v; statement s; @@ <+...
